The owner of an electronics store received a shipment of MP3 players at a cost of $64.25 each. If he sells the MP3 players for $99.99 each, what is the percent of markup? Round to the nearest whole percent.
A. 6%
B. 36%** (my answer)
C. 56%
D. 62%

(99.99/64.25) * 100% = 156%.
Markup = 156% - 100% = 56%.
